A stretch of a busy Glasgow motorway is currently closed due to a "police incident".
Police responded to the scene on the M8 at junction 17 after the alarm was raised at around 7.35am.
The force confirmed officers remain in attendance.
In an update, Traffic Scotland announced all westbound traffic is currently leaving the carriageway at junction 16.
Drivers are being warned that traffic is queuing on approach.

A Police Scotland spokesperson said: "Around 7.35am on Sunday, November 28, officers were called to a road crash on the M8 at J17.
"The road is currently closed and police are at the scene."
